A bulletproof backpack is a type of backpack that combines traditional carrying functions with ballistic protection, designed to provide extra safety in emergency situations such as shootings. Here are some key features of a bulletproof backpack:
Ballistic Materials: The interior of a bulletproof backpack is typically lined with high-strength ballistic materials such as Kevlar (Aramid fiber) or Ultra-High Molecular Weight Polyethylene (UHMWPE). These materials are lightweight and offer excellent protection.
Portability: Bulletproof backpacks are designed for everyday use, suitable for students, office workers, and other individuals. They look like ordinary backpacks but provide additional safety.
Multi-functionality: In addition to ballistic protection, bulletproof backpacks usually feature multiple compartments for storing books, laptops, stationery, and other daily essentials.
Lightweight Design: Despite containing ballistic materials, bulletproof backpacks are designed to be as lightweight as possible to reduce the burden on the user.
Emergency Protection: In emergency situations, the user can use the backpack as a temporary shield to provide immediate protection.
Bulletproof backpacks are gaining attention in schools, offices, and other places, especially as an extra safety measure in the event of school shootings.
